Title:
  Please support the native bios format for dec alpha

Status in QEMU:
  Won't Fix

Bug description:
  Currently qemu-system-alpha -bios parameter takes an ELF image.
  However HP maintains firmware updates for those systems.

  Some example rom files can be found here
  
ftp://ftp.hp.com/pub/alphaserver/firmware/current_platforms/v7.3_release/DS20_DS20e/

  It might allow things like using the SRM firmware.
  The ARC(nt) firmware would allow to build and test windows applications for 
that platforms without having the relevant hardware

[Qemu-devel] [Bug 1473451] Re: Please support the native bios format for dec alpha

2017-07-29 Thread Richard Henderson
QEMU does not really implement a "true" ev67.

We cheat and implement something that is significantly faster to emulate.
E.g. doing all TLB refill within qemu, rather than in the PALcode.

So, no, there's no chance of running true SRM or ARC firmware.
